Here are a few of my favorite ways to wear metallic makeup like a pro:

Eyes – Laura Mercier Caviar Stick Eye Shadow ($29)

Eyeshadow is a super easy way to wear the metallic makeup trend. Gold and rose gold are still everywhere and both colors are super universal. Use a metallic shadow like this one from Laura Mercier in Magnetic Pink all over your lid, or just along your lashes as a liner. Of course the full look is pictured above. (I received the shade Magnetic Pink complimentary for testing, but purchased the other two shades pictured above.) Additionally, if you prefer regular eye shadow, Sephora Collection has some great metallic options. Unsurprisingly, I like the shade Diving In ($8) for my favorite blue eyeshadow look. If you go for an all over shadow, blend a neutral color into your crease for a day look, or spice it up with a darker tone for an evening out. Finally, swipe on a light pink or neutral lippie and you’re good to go.

Lips – Sephora Cream Lip Stain – Metallic Cherry – $14

Looking for something a bit bolder? Try a metallic lip using this cream lip stain from Sephora or this liquid lip from Smashbox. Coupled with a classic nude eye and sharp winged liner, you are sure to stand out. Although, you already know this look is one of my favorites. I’ll make any excuse for winged liner and red lips.

Nails – Smith & Cult nail polish – Sugarette – $18

Surprisingly, one of the simplest ways to wear metallic makeup is on your hands! Even my local nail salon has been showcasing some amazing chrome gel polishes lately. From chrome to rose gold to unicorn looks, metallic nail polish is a great way to show off your gilded personality.
